Population Overview
Biddeford city is a small city located in Maine, within York County. The total population is 22,463. It ranks as the 6th most populous out of 155 cities and towns in Maine.
Age Demographics
The median age in Biddeford city is 36.1 years. This is 19% lower than the state median of 44.8 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Biddeford city is $69,794. This is 3% lower than the state median of $71,773.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 11% lower. The poverty rate stands at 15.3%. This is 42% higher than the state poverty rate of 10.8%. The unemployment rate is 3.1%. This is 22% lower than the state rate of 3.9%. The median home value is $349,300. Housing costs are 31% higher than the state median of $266,400. The home-value-to-income ratio is 5.0x. 48.8%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 34% lower than the state average of 74.0%.
Race & Ethnicity
Biddeford city has a predominantly White (non-Hispanic) population, comprising 92.3% of all residents. Hispanic or Latino residents account for 2.5%.
Education
30.4%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 14% lower than the state rate of 35.3%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 94.5%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Biddeford city, Maine is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Maine state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 155 Census-designated places in Maine.
